Local context

Kharkiv decisions require a safety-first plan that can change quickly

This guide covers the current city of Kharkiv in Kharkivska oblast, Ukraine—not the wider oblast and not a historical boundary. Kharkiv City Council remains active and identifies the municipality through its official address and services. Its first-half 2026 report says municipal social-service providers supported older people, people with disabilities, internally displaced people, and residents in difficult circumstances. Those administrative facts establish a functioning city and a changing support environment; they do not describe any individual, prove that a service is reachable today, measure demand for coaching, or guarantee safety, electricity, communications, transport, work, housing, or an appointment.

Current conditions make continuity part of any coaching comparison. The city reported ongoing strikes and frontline pressures in August 2026, while WHO's April 2025 national health-needs assessment found substantial mental-health symptoms and access barriers, especially in frontline regions. FCDO advice remained restrictive when this page was reviewed. These sources must not be converted into a prediction about one resident or used as travel, shelter, evacuation, legal, or security guidance. Official alerts, Ukrainian authorities, emergency and humanitarian services, qualified clinicians, and trusted local contacts take priority. A coach may help with a non-clinical decision record, adaptable weekly routines, or a work-transition plan only when contact itself is safe and appropriate.

These overlapping directory fields do not prove Ukrainian or Russian language fluency, knowledge of Kharkiv, lawful Ukraine coverage, safe communications, working payment rails, clinical competence, or current availability. Before sharing personal information or paying, confirm identity, jurisdiction, service legality, platform access, data handling, recording policy, time zone, session contingency, referrals, and complete cost. Coaching is not emergency response, psychotherapy, medical care, humanitarian casework, evacuation assistance, legal advice, or security planning.

Research-informed needs

Decisions a coach may help structure in Kharkiv

These are practical applications derived from local institutional and economic evidence. They are not invented search-volume rankings or claims about every resident.

Continuity for work and study goals

Why it belongs here

Kharkiv's municipal services and WHO's national assessment show that ordinary plans operate alongside displacement, infrastructure pressure, and interruptions. They do not establish a person's location, employment, enrollment, capacity, or safe access today.

Useful coaching scope

A coach may help define a small next action, an interruption rule, and a low-burden record that can pause without penalty. Employers, schools, authorities, aid organizations, clinicians, and emergency services determine access, eligibility, and safety.

Decisions after displacement or role change

Why it belongs here

The city reports serving internally displaced people and residents facing difficult circumstances. That is service-volume context, not evidence about a particular household, benefit, job, housing option, or readiness for coaching.

Useful coaching scope

Non-clinical coaching may help compare values, transferable skills, and reversible options after authoritative needs are addressed. Humanitarian, social, employment, housing, legal, and health professionals should handle matters within their mandates.

Clinical and emergency boundaries

Why it belongs here

WHO identifies elevated mental-health need and pressure on health access during the war. Aggregate need does not diagnose a visitor or establish that coaching is suitable, available, or sufficient.

Useful coaching scope

A responsible coach should screen scope, pause when urgent or clinical needs appear, and refer without presenting coaching as treatment. Immediate danger, severe symptoms, trauma treatment, medication, diagnosis, or crisis belongs with qualified local services.

How matching works in practice

Example: rebuilding a work routine around interruptions

This is a hypothetical Kharkiv decision exercise, not a resident, displaced person, worker, survivor, client, testimonial, security plan, or promised result.

Situation

An adult wants to resume a professional qualification while work, caregiving, connectivity, and personal safety can change. Unknowns include safe contact, current course access, employer expectations, documents, clinical support, privacy, platform function, payment, and how sessions stop during an alert or outage.

What a local coach may add

A Kharkiv-based coach may share language and local context if meeting or contact is safe. Local knowledge never replaces official alerts, emergency services, humanitarian support, qualified clinical care, employers, schools, lawyers, or responsible authorities.

What an international coach may add

An international coach may offer a flexible planning method if lawful Ukraine coverage, privacy, language, platform access, payment support, referrals, and an interruption protocol are confirmed. No workaround should be attempted when a platform, payment provider, law, or safety condition blocks service.

A defensible decision

First confirm that coaching is safe, lawful, non-clinical, and lower priority than urgent needs; choose one reversible weekly action and a no-fault pause rule; request the actual billed currency and a complete Ukrainian-hryvnia and U.S.-dollar comparison including applicable tax, payment and conversion fees, package scope, cancellation, refund, expiration, and renewal; and stop if safety, privacy, legal, clinical, payment, or communications questions remain unresolved.

Questions to ask every coach

  1. 1Can you work in Ukrainian, Russian, English, or my preferred language without assuming language from my location?
  2. 2Are you legally and operationally able to serve a person in Ukraine, and which platform, privacy, data-location, and payment limits must we verify first?
  3. 3How will sessions pause during an official alert, outage, displacement, urgent need, or loss of private space without penalizing me?
  4. 4How do you distinguish non-clinical coaching from trauma treatment, crisis response, humanitarian help, legal advice, and security planning?
  5. 5What one decision record, adaptable routine, or verified conversation should exist after four safe sessions?
  6. 6What is the actual billed currency and the complete price in Ukrainian hryvnia and U.S. dollars, including applicable tax, payment and conversion fees, package scope, cancellation, refund, expiration, and renewal?
  7. 7When would you stop coaching and refer me to an authority, emergency service, humanitarian organization, social service, employer, lawyer, or clinician?

Practical safeguards

Safety outranks the session

Follow current official alerts and trusted local instructions. A coaching appointment is always deferrable and must never compete with emergency, humanitarian, clinical, or security needs.

Minimize sensitive data

Before sharing personal history, documents, locations, recordings, or contacts, verify privacy, data location, lawful access, retention, deletion, and what happens when connectivity fails.

Reject workarounds

If law, sanctions, a platform, a payment provider, or current conditions prevent service, do not seek an evasion method. Pause and obtain qualified legal or provider guidance.

Non-clinical boundary

Life coaching is non-clinical support for goals, decisions, habits, and accountability. It is not psychotherapy, medical care, crisis care, legal advice, or financial advice, and it does not replace licensed professionals.
